Wednesday’s national forecast

Anticyclonic for most of New Zealand on Wednesday. A front approaches the lower South Island from the west moving in overnight.

Northland, Auckland, Waikato & Bay Of Plenty
Mostly sunny, southwesterly winds.
Highs: 26-29

Western North Island (including Central North Island)
Morning cloud with the risk of a shower then sunny areas increase, light winds tend westerly in the afternoon.
Highs: 23-26

Eastern North Island
Sunny with afternoon east to northeast winds.
Highs: 26-28

Wellington
Sunny with light northerly winds.
High: 23-24

Marlborough & Nelson
Sunny with afternoon north to northeasterly winds.
Highs: 25-28

Canterbury
Any morning cloud clears then sunny with freshening east to northeasterly winds in the afternoon.
Highs: 26-28

West Coast
Mostly sunny after any morning cloud breaks away, cloud thickens in the afternoon for Fiordland with the odd shower then rain develops overnight. North to northeasterly winds for South Westland, afternoon westerlies for North Westland.
Highs: 21-28

Southland & Otago
Mostly sunny with some high cloud later in the day, northerly winds for most however east to northeast winds for coastal Otago. Overnight showers for Southland.
Highs: 23-31
